Exploring Lithium Battery Systems

Continuing this journey into the realm of lithium battery systems, it’s essential to highlight that staying ahead in this industry requires constant innovation and upgrade of techniques. Implementing advanced technologies ensures that the end products meet rising consumer expectations, particularly as electric vehicles and renewable energy systems gain traction. What’s more, a focus on sustainability through effective recycling and reuse of components also paves the way for eco-friendly manufacturing processes.

Reinforcing Production Techniques

As we dig deeper into the evolution of lithium battery systems, manufacturers must invest in training their workforce to handle emerging technologies. The integration of AI into production lines facilitates improved predictive maintenance, which not only enhances uptime but also significantly reduces the operational costs associated with machinery failures. In this fast-paced environment, fostering a culture of continuous improvement and embracing new talent and paradigms can enhance competitive advantage and operational efficacy.
